Roger Casement Papers,
1889-1945
A collection of letters, poems, articles and other documents of Roger Casement and his family. Covering his career in the British Diplomatic Service and activities in the Irish Revolutionary movement, 1889-1945.

Letter from Alfred Mitchell-Innes to Roger Casement, questioning whether they are doing good with imposing their government, laws and teachings on those they call "savages",
1912 Mar. 09.
In Collection: | Roger Casement Papers, 1889-1945 |
---|---|
Description: | Mitchell-Innesgoes on to say about civilisation and the need for money: "....is not all this merely the glorification of avarice, meanness, want of human love, base passion which the savage is free from?.....Which is the savage---they or us?". |
